How it works

Run or walk an accumulative 2,000 miles (3218.688 km) and earn the limited edition finisher’s medal inspired by Japanese artist Katsushika Hokusai. Some ways to get 2,000 miles done:

  • Keep adding miles after you get past your 1,000 or 1,500 mile challenge!
  • Run 1,000 miles a year for two years.
  • Run 38.4 miles a week for 52 weeks.
  • Average at least 5.4 miles per day for 1 year.
  • What matters is you challenge yourself and go the distance.
  • Signing up with a running partner makes it even more fun!

You can track your progress using our online Run Tracker and unlock cool digital badges and levels. The medal will ship out in June. It could take longer to reach you depending on where you live.
